LONDON, February 7, 2008 — BNY Mellon Asset Servicing B.V. has been appointed by Stichting Pensioenfonds OPG to provide global custody, investment accounting, regulatory reporting, performance measurement, attribution and analytics for assets worth EUR 219 million.

The OPG Group is an international retail and distribution company for pharmaceuticals and medical supplies and has operations in the Netherlands, Poland, Belgium, Germany, Denmark, Norway, Hungary and Switzerland.

BNY Mellon Asset Servicing B.V. will be working closely with the Blue Sky Group, the fiduciary manager recently hired by OPG to provide advisory and investment management services to the fund.

Johan van der Veen, Managing Director at Pensioenfonds OPG, said: "Our pension fund is relatively small in size and therefore relies heavily on outsourcing, and so when it came to enhancing our custody and investment accounting BNY Mellon Asset Servicing B.V. was the ideal choice due to its comprehensive product suite and local servicing capabilities."

BNY Mellon Asset Servicing offers clients worldwide a broad spectrum of specialised asset servicing capabilities, including custody and fund services, securities lending, performance and analytics, and execution services. BNY Mellon Asset Servicing provides services through The Bank of New York, Mellon Bank, N.A. and other related companies.

The Bank of New York Mellon Corporation is a global financial services company focused on helping clients manage and service their financial assets, operating in 34 countries and serving more than 100 markets. The company is a leading provider of financial services for institutions, corporations and high-net-worth individuals, providing superior asset management and wealth management, asset servicing, issuer services, clearing services and treasury services through a worldwide client-focused team. It has more than $20 trillion in assets under custody and administration, more than $1.1 trillion in assets under management and services $11 trillion in outstanding debt.
